The Public JSC National nuclear energy generating company "Energoatom" () is the public enterprise operating all four nuclear power plants in Ukraine (Zaporizhzhia, Rivne, South Ukraine, and Khmelnytskyi). It is the largest producer of electricity in Ukraine.

== Overview == State Enterprise "National Nuclear Energy Generating Company Energoatom" was founded in October 1996. The company operates four nuclear power plants in Ukraine consisting of 15 units (13 VVER-1000 units and 2 VVER-440 units) with a total installed capacity of 13,835 MW. The company also operates two hydroelectric units at the Oleksandrivska Hydroelectric Plant with the installed capacity of 25 MW and three hydroelectric units at the Tashlyk Pumped-Storage Power Plant with the installed capacity of 453 MW (the hydroelectric unit No. 3 was connected to the power system in 2022).
